#6be9ce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6be9ce is composed of 42% red, 91.4% green and 80.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 11.6% yellow and 8.6% black. It has a hue angle of 167.1 degrees, a saturation of 74.1% and a lightness of 66.7%. #6be9ce color hex could be obtained by blending #d6ffff with #00d39d. Closest websafe color is: #66ffcc.

Shades and Tints of #6be9ce

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010605 is the darkest color, while #f4fdf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#6be9ce

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a6aeac is the less saturated color, while #57fdd9 is the most saturated one.
